Versatility and Additional Functions
Dairy machinery that incorporates multiple functions can improve production flexibility. Apart from separating cream, some equipment integrates capabilities such as pasteurization or even churning butter, reducing the need for separate machines. Assessing whether a machine can adapt to various dairy processes can optimize space and cost, making it an attractive option for producers seeking to diversify their product lines without major additional investments.
